HERE are the transport ideals for Yorkshire:

1. Reopen railway stations at Haxby and Strensall, plus a halt at York Hospital.

2. Electrify with overhead wires between Copmanthorpe and Neville Hill, and reopen station at Copmanthorpe.

3. Electrify the line from Hull to Liverpool.

4. HS2 to have York included in the scheme. Dual the A1237 ring road right through from Copmanthorpe to Hopgrove.

5. Dual the A64 from Leeds to Scarborough.

However, these will always remain but a pipe dream.

The reason being all the above are some 200 miles north of London. Also, the funding for Yorkshire stops in a siding after Stevenage.
